SpringBoot整合Mybatis訪問數據庫和alibaba druid數據源

1、加入依賴(可以用 http://start.spring.io/ 下載)

        <!--加入mybatis依賴-->
        <!-- 引入starter-->
        <dependency>
            <groupId>org.mybatis.spring.boot</groupId>
            <artifactId>mybatis-spring-boot-starter</artifactId>
            <version>2.1.1</version>
        </dependency>
        <!-- MySQL的JDBC驅動包	-->
        <dependency>
            <groupId>mysql</groupId>
            <artifactId>mysql-connector-java</artifactId>
            <scope>runtime</scope>
        </dependency>
        <!-- 引入第三方數據源 -->
        <dependency>
            <groupId>com.alibaba</groupId>
            <artifactId>druid</artifactId>
            <version>1.1.6</version>
        </dependency>

2、加入配置文件

#springBoot可以自動識別數據庫驅動,所以下邊的這個驅動配置可以不加
#spring.datasource.driver-class-name =com.mysql.jdbc.Driver

spring.datasource.url=jdbc:mysql://192.168.1.188:3306/wx_pay?useUnicode=true&characterEncoding=utf-8
spring.datasource.username =root
spring.datasource.password =password
#如果不使用配置數據源的話,將使用默認的數據源 (com.zaxxer.hikari.HikariDataSource)
spring.datasource.type =com.alibaba.druid.pool.DruidDataSource
​

加載配置,注入到sqlSessionFactory等都是springBoot幫我們完成,很方便

3、啓動類增加mapper掃描

4、開發mapper和service

訪問測試一下

可以看到已經可以訪問數據庫拿到數據了

發佈了86 篇原創文章 · 獲贊 74 · 訪問量 4萬+
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章